Abstract

A magnetic memory device includes a first signal line (BL) and a second signal line (/BL) extended column-wise; a third signal line (WL) extended row-wise; a memory cell including a first parallelly connected set which is disposed at the intersection of the first signal line and the third signal line, including a first magnetoresistive effect element (MTJ) and a first select transistor (Tr) and having one end connected to the first signal line; a second parallelly connected set which is disposed at the intersection of the second signal line and the third signal line, including a second magnetoresistive effect element (MTJ) and a second select transistor (Tr) and having one end connected to the second signal line; and a read circuit connected to the first signal line and the second signal line, for reading information memorized in the memory cell, based on voltages of the first signal line and the second signal line.
